Output 0843d6aab5c9053bd7979275b10e099f19c28f90173a66ebd8dd3396b0936898:1

value
37148883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f31012cc1bae83922528c6c5b9f8e0e67610b1 OP_EQUAL
address
MJZXnyrPqrcaqrvrW8XYYGr1z8RuVE3ohB
transaction
0843d6aab5c9053bd7979275b10e099f19c28f90173a66ebd8dd3396b0936898
spent
true